Tan Viet Noodle House

Vietnamese

Ga da don,crisp-skin chicken,is the speciality at this double-fronted,cavernously deep eatery,and the weekend queues for it are legendary. Wafer-thin flaky skin and tender juicy meat are moreish on their own,and utterly addictive when dipped in fluoro-red chilli sauce. The chicken arrives within seconds of ordering,with a choice of rice noodle soup,egg noodles (soupy or dry) or the crowd favourite,tomato rice. Bo kho (spicy beef stew) with tender beef,tendons and carrot is a hearty alternative;again you can have it with rice or egg noodles,but hey,you’re in Cabramatta - order it with a fresh Vietnamese bread roll.
